Exploring Shared Rhythms of Spain and Latin America
About this Event

Guided by a storyteller, this captivating performance draws the audience into the vibrant world of flamenco, uncovering its roots in Spain and the Latin American influences that have shaped its evolution. Through dynamic dance, evocative music, and engaging narration, the show highlights flamenco’s ability to transcend borders, reflecting the interconnectedness of cultures and the exchange of artistic traditions. Audiences are invited to experience the rhythm, passion, and emotion of flamenco while reflecting on its complex histories and shared cultural threads that continue to inspire and resonate today.

What is flamenco?

Flamenco, originating from Spain's Andalusian region, is a mesmerizing art form celebrated for its captivating dance, music, and song. The dance, or "baile," is a spellbinding display of rhythmic footwork, precise movements, and emotive gestures, all performed with a raw intensity that speaks to the depths of human emotion. Dancers, adorned in vibrant, ruffled costumes, command the stage with their graceful yet powerful expressions, interpreting the music's nuances with every step. From intricate, percussive footwork to dramatic poses, flamenco dance is a breathtaking fusion of passion, tradition, and self-expression, captivating audiences with its unparalleled beauty and raw authenticity.
